The multiplier is the heart of the crash game. It starts at 1x and continually increases, creating the potential for substantial winnings. The longer you wait to cash out, the higher the multiplier climbs, and the greater your potential payout. However, this increased potential comes with a corresponding increase in risk. At any point, the multiplier can “crash,” resulting in a loss of your entire bet. This element of unpredictability is what makes crash games both exciting and challenging. For players at thecrashcasino-ca.ca, it’s important to remember that each round is independent; previous results have no bearing on future outcomes. This means there’s no predictable pattern to exploit, reinforcing the need for a disciplined approach. A common mistake new players make is chasing losses, continuing to increase their bets after a crash, hoping to recover their funds quickly. This can lead to a rapid depletion of their bankroll and should be avoided.

Effective bankroll management is arguably the most crucial aspect of crash game strategy. Before you begin playing, determine a specific amount of money you're willing to risk and stick to that limit. Divide your bankroll into smaller units, and only bet a small percentage of your total bankroll on each round. This prevents you from losing a significant portion of your funds in a short period. A common rule of thumb is to never bet more than 1-5% of your bankroll on a single bet. Furthermore, set win and loss limits. Once you reach your win limit, stop playing and enjoy your profits. Similarly, if you reach your loss limit, walk away and avoid chasing losses.
